文章 2024-11-14 来自:开发者社区

【赵渝强老师】Oracle的联机重做日志文件与数据写入过程

在Oracle数据库中,一个数据库可以有多个联机重做日志文件,它记录了数据库的变化。例如,当Oracle数据库产生异常时,导致对数据的改变没有及时写入到数据文件中。这时Oracle数据库就会根据联机重做日志文件中的信息来获得数据库的变化信息,并根据这些信息把这些改变写到数据文件中。换句话来说,联机重做日志文件中记录的重做日志可以用来进行数据库实例的恢复。 视频讲解如下: ...

【赵渝强老师】Oracle的联机重做日志文件与数据写入过程
文章 2023-05-29 来自:开发者社区

Oracle联机交易性能优化一例

当前瓶颈分析tps测试目前只有300,从awr报告中可以看到目前的等待事情如下:分析:第一个等待事件,logfile的200M太小。第二个,第三个都是读,需要想办法把数据提前load进内存,减少物理读。第四个是要提高离散写的性能。第5个等待事件是因为大量的insert并发,竞争datafile的高水位锁造成的,改成分区表可以解决这个问题,但用户不让,那只能减少把并发数。优化措施增加logfile....

Oracle联机交易性能优化一例
文章 2023-05-27 来自:开发者社区

Oracle 的联机日志文件

1、联机日志的相关概念1.1 概念联机日志文件又叫重做日志文件,记录了对数据库修改的信息,一个 Oracle 实例有一组或多组联机日志文件,每组包含一个或多个日志成员,同一组的日志成员内容相同,存放位置不同,防止日志文件组内某个日志文件损坏导致数据丢失。lgwr 进程负责将数据写入日志文件,如果一组日志文件被写满,会自动切换到下一组日志文件。当所有的日志文件都被写满时,如果数据库为非归档模式,则....

文章 2022-12-15 来自:开发者社区

在Oracle中,如何管理联机Redo日志组与成员?

常用SQL以下是常见操作,若在RAC下则需要添加线程号:-- 增加一个日志文件组: ALTER DATABASE ADD LOGFILE [GROUP N] '文件全名' SIZE 10M; ALTER DATABASE ADD LOGFILE THREAD 1 GROUP 4 ('+DATA','+FRA') SIZE 50M; -- 在这个组上增加一个成员: ALTER DATABA...

文章 2017-11-16 来自:开发者社区

Oracle当前联机日志组损坏的处理

Oracle当前联机日志组损坏的处理   一oracle 日志的特性总结   1 oracle 日志切换规律(从最大sequence#号切换到最小sequence#号)   eg 如下所示:下个当前日志组会是sequence#号为27的5号日志组 SQL> select group#,archived,sequence#,statu...

文章 2017-11-14 来自:开发者社区

Oracle RMAN备份深入解析--联机备份

RMAN> backup database plus archivelog;   此命令将触发以下操作:    1、首先,进程使用alter system archivelog current命令完成了日志切换操作。    2、进程将现存所有归档重做日志备份    3、开始执行实际的数据库备份操作,此时会发生一次...

文章 2017-11-12 来自:开发者社区

Oracle 联机重做日志文件(ONLINE LOG FILE)

-- Oracle 联机重做日志文件(ONLINE LOG FILE) --=========================================   一、Oracle中的几类日志文件     Redo log files      -->联...

文章 2017-11-12 来自:开发者社区

ORACLE联机日志文件丢失或损坏的处理方法(转)

经验总结: 联机日志分为当前联机日志和非当前联机日志,非当前联机日志的损坏是比较简单的,一般通过clear命令就可以解决问题。 损坏非当前联机日志: 1、启动数据库,遇到ORA-00312 or ORA-00313错误,如: ORA-00313: open failed for members of log group 4 of thread 1 ORA-00312: online log 3 ....

文章 2013-12-28 来自:开发者社区

oracle联机重做日志文件丢失&&&&Oracle错误ORA-03113: end-of-file on communication channel处理办法

一: 1.  在oracle正常运行过程中,强行删除联机重做数据库,而后强制关闭数据库 SQL> host rm -rf '/u01/oradata/orcl/redo01.log' SQL> shutdown abort; ORACLE instance shut down 2.而后重启数据库,出现如下错误 SQL> startup ORACLE instance s...

文章 2010-07-20 来自:开发者社区

Oracle 联机重做日志文件(ONLINE LOG FILE)

--========================================= -- Oracle 联机重做日志文件(ONLINE LOG FILE) --=========================================   一、Oracle中的几类日志文件     Redo log files   &...

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

相关镜像